I'm kind of lost here the aos packet states that another medical isn't required if the k1 beneficiary arrived with-in the last 12 months, but then it goes on to state form I693 is required.
How can anyone fill out this form accurately if during the medical exam the required vaccines were put into a sealed envelope and giving to the uscis?
any information would be greatly appreciated,thanks
The beneficiary is given the sealed vaccines records which shows what shots were given during their medical in their country. He/she may not need a medical. But if their shots were not complete they will need to see a CS to get the missing shots and have them transcribed into the I-693.
It's really up to you. I have heard of some people simply sending in the attached DS-3025 and not having a problem. (They peeked at the DS-3025) I myself wanted to be safe so we went to a Civil Surgeon since they are designated by the USCIS to look at the forms and complete any paperwork necessary for the packet. Hope this helps.
